Indica, sativa and hybrid are a retail shopping convention — not a reliable guide to genetics or effects. When researchers analysed 89,923 commercial samples across six states, these labels did not predict a plant’s terpene or cannabinoid profile, and a genome-wide study found sativa- and indica-labelled plants to be genetically indistinct (PLOS ONE 2022; Nature Plants 2021). The labels are so fluid that AK-47, a hybrid, won “Best Sativa” at the 1999 Cannabis Cup and “Best Indica” four years later. For an accurate, genetics-true picture, see the chemotype above.

About Wildfire

Wildfire is a cross of Straight Fire from Jinxproof Genetics to our Animal Cookies male. Expect high yielding plants with extremely frost coverage and beautiful colors. The terp profile ranges from chocolate gas and mint to sweet pine coffee and cookies
